Higgsfield is an AI video and image platform that competes on cinematic camera control rather than raw text-to-video quality. Co-founders: Alex Mashrabov (former head of generative AI at Snap), Yerzat Dulat, and Mahi de Silva. The company publicly launched its video generation tools on March 31, 2025.

As of the June 12, 2026 refresh, Higgsfield’s about page positions the platform at 50M+ users, 5M+ creators, 300M+ videos, 2M+ videos created daily, and 6M+ total creations daily. Treat older user-count, run-rate, and funding figures as historical context unless separately re-verified.

The differentiator is the shot language. Cinema Studio exposes per-shot camera moves (dolly, orbit, push-in, crane, tilt). Soul anchors character identity across generations. Lipsync and talking-avatar surfaces cover dubbed clips. Higgsfield also exposes Explore, Image, Video, Audio, Supercomputer, MCP & CLI, Plugins, Collab, Marketing Studio, Cinema Studio, AI Influencer, and Canvas surfaces, while orchestrating models such as Kling, Seedance, Veo, Sora, Nano Banana, Wan, Flux, Soul, and Cinema.

System Verdict

Pick Higgsfield if your video work depends on camera language, character consistency, or short-form vertical output. Cinema Studio has one of the deepest per-shot camera UIs in the category. Soul gives you a repeatable character across clips, which Runway and Pika still wrestle with. The aggregated-model approach means you can pick the best backbone per shot without juggling subscriptions.

Skip it if you need long clips, low-cost API automation, or pure generation quality. Max clip lengths still depend on the underlying model. API/MCP/CLI economics start to make sense at Ultra or Team scale, and the current pricing page warns that unlimited/free-generation benefits apply on higgsfield.ai rather than MCP, CLI, Canvas, or Supercomputer. For raw quality benchmarks, Veo and Seedance usually lead head-to-head tests.

Who pays which tier: Free to evaluate, Starter $15/mo annual for hobby creators, Plus $39/mo annual for working short-form creators who need all models and higher parallelism, Ultra $99/mo annual for agencies or power users needing more credits plus one 365-day unlimited video model, and Teams from $59/seat/mo annual when shared credits, SSO, no-training language, indemnification, SLA, analytics, and Slack support matter.

What it actually is

A multi-model video studio with an opinionated camera-language layer on top. Rather than a single proprietary model, Higgsfield routes each job to the best available backbone. Seedance 2.0 for photoreal motion. Kling 3.0 for quick turnarounds. Veo 3 for complex prompts. Nano Banana and Soul V2 for image work.

Cinema Studio adds per-shot camera control (dolly, orbit, push-in, crane, static, handheld) and style transfer. Motion Control supports longer clips with sustained camera moves. Soul lets you fix a character’s face across generations, reducing the identity-drift problem that still plagues most text-to-video tools.

Lipsync Studio and Talking Avatar handle dubbed video, so a single image plus a voice track produces a talking-head clip.

Credit consumption varies by model. As of June 12, 2026, the pricing matrix showed examples such as Seedance 2.0 720p at 22 credits per 5 seconds, Seedance 2.0 Fast at 17 credits per 5 seconds, Kling 3.0 at 7-8 credits per 5 seconds, Google Veo 3.1 Fast at 11 credits per 4 seconds, Google Veo 3.1 at 29 credits per 4 seconds, and Veo 3 at 58 credits per 8 seconds. Nano Banana Pro / 2 image generations were listed at 2 credits per image.

When to pick Higgsfield

  • Camera-driven shots. Product reveal dollies, orbiting hero shots, cinematic push-ins. Cinema Studio 3.5 is the strongest per-shot camera UI in the category.
  • Short-form vertical content. TikTok, Reels, and Shorts creators get 15-25 finished Plus-tier clips per month, with the camera language that makes scroll-stopping openers.
  • Character-consistent storylines. Soul ID anchors a recurring character across clips for serialized short content.
  • Lipsync and talking avatars. Lipsync Studio produces usable dubbed heads from a single image plus a voice track.
  • Multi-model experimentation. One subscription, access to Kling, Seedance, Veo, Sora, Nano Banana, Wan. Useful when you are still picking a winning model per style.

When to pick something else

  • Highest generation quality, head-to-head: Veo 3 (via Gemini) and Seedance lead most blind comparisons. Higgsfield uses these underneath, but without its per-shot layer the direct tools are cheaper.
  • Long-form narrative video: Runway supports longer sequences and a deeper edit timeline. Higgsfield clips cap around 16-30 seconds.
  • Image-to-video simplicity: Luma and Pika are faster from a single still.
  • Chinese-market prompts or styles: Kling, Hailuo, Jimeng, or Wan directly.
  • Talking-avatar specialists: Hedra and Argil go deeper on avatar fidelity and cloning.

Failure modes

  • Clip length ceiling. Most models cap at 8-16 seconds; 30 seconds only on Motion Control. Long-form requires stitching multiple shots, which breaks motion continuity.
  • Credit model demands arithmetic. Per-model costs range from low single-digit image credits to dozens of credits for short frontier video clips. Running out of credits mid-project is common if the team does not test the exact model mix first.
  • Annual billing anchor. Listed monthly prices ($15, $39, $99) are annual-commitment rates. True month-to-month is ~25% higher.
  • MCP/CLI/API value starts high. Developers should not assume Plus-tier unlimited promos carry into MCP, CLI, Canvas, or Supercomputer. The published pricing caveat makes web-app and automation economics materially different.
  • Output quality depends on underlying model. Higgsfield’s moat is orchestration and camera UI, not the base model. When Veo 3.1 ships with new capabilities, users get them here; when the underlying models lag, Higgsfield lags.
  • Free tier is watermarked and non-commercial. Acceptable for evaluation, unusable for actual client work.
  • Team controls are improving but still procurement-heavy. Teams lists SOC 2, custom SSO, no-training language, indemnification, SLA, analytics, and Slack support, but buyers should verify contract terms before regulated or client-sensitive production.
  • Character drift at edge cases. Soul ID holds up for headshots and standard framing; unusual angles and heavy motion still break identity.

FAQ

Is Higgsfield free to use? Yes, with limits. Treat the free tier as evaluation only and verify watermark/commercial terms before using output for client work. Starter at $15/month annual is the first paid individual tier; Plus is the better first serious tier if you need all models and higher parallelism.

What is the current flagship model? Higgsfield is model-agnostic. It orchestrates Seedance 2.0 / Fast, Kling 3.0, Veo 3.1, Veo 3, Sora 2 tiers, Nano Banana Pro / 2, Wan 2.6, Flux.2 Pro, Soul V2, and Cinema. The proprietary differentiator is the camera/character layer, not one base model.

Does Higgsfield have an API? Higgsfield now promotes MCP & CLI plus higher-end automation surfaces, but the pricing page also says unlimited models and free-generation allowances apply only on higgsfield.ai, not MCP, CLI, Canvas, or Supercomputer. If API-first workflow matters and budget is tight, compare Runway, Luma, Pika, and Kling before committing.
